What is the probability of rolling a 6 on a fair, 6-sided die?
The probability of rolling a 6 on a fair, 6-sided die is 1/6, or approximately 16.67%.
If a bag contains 5 red marbles, 3 blue marbles, and 2 green marbles, what is the probability of randomly selecting a red marble?
The probability of randomly selecting a red marble from the bag would be 5/10, which simplifies to 1/2 or 0.5.
A deck of cards contains 52 cards, with 4 suits and 13 cards in each suit. What is the probability of drawing a diamond from a deck of cards?
The probability of drawing a diamond from a deck of cards is 1/4, since there are four suits in a deck of cards and one of them is diamonds. This means there is a 25% chance of drawing a diamond card from the deck.
A basketball player has a 70% free throw shooting percentage. What is the probability that they will make at least 2 out of 3 free throws?
To find the probability that the basketball player makes at least 2 out of 3 free throws, we can calculate the probability of making exactly 2 free throws and the probability of making all 3 free throws, and then sum them together. The probability of making exactly 2 free throws is 3C2 * (0.7)^2 * (0.3)^1 = 0.441, and the probability of making all 3 free throws is (0.7)^3 = 0.343. Adding these two probabilities together gives us a total probability of 0.441 + 0.343 = 0.784, or 78.4%. Therefore, there is a 78.4% chance that the basketball player will make at least 2 out of 3 free throws.
In a game of chance, there is a 1 in 20 probability of winning a prize. If you play the game 5 times, what is the probability of winning at least once?
To calculate the probability of winning at least once in 5 games where the probability of winning is 1/20, we can use the complement rule and find the probability of not winning in any of the 5 games, which is (19/20)^5. The probability of winning at least once is then 1 - (19/20)^5, which is approximately 0.204, or 20.4%.
A jar contains 10 red candies and 5 blue candies. If a candy is randomly selected, what is the probability of selecting a red candy?
The probability of selecting a red candy from the jar is 10/(10+5) = 10/15 = 2/3 or approximately 0.67.
A spinner is divided into 6 equal sections, numbered 1-6. What is the probability of spinning an odd number?
The probability of spinning an odd number on a spinner with 6 equal sections numbered 1-6 is 3/6, which simplifies to 1/2. This is because there are 3 odd numbers (1, 3, 5) out of the total 6 possible outcomes.
The weather forecast predicts a 30% chance of rain tomorrow. What is the probability that it will not rain?
The probability that it will not rain tomorrow is 70%, as it is the complement of the 30% chance of rain (100% - 30% = 70%).
In a classroom of 30 students, 15 are boys and 15 are girls. If a student is randomly selected, what is the probability of selecting a girl?
The probability of selecting a girl from a classroom with 30 students, where 15 are girls, would be 15 out of the total 30 students, which simplifies to 1/2 or 0.5. Therefore, the probability of selecting a girl is 0.5 or 50%.
A standard deck of cards is shuffled and one card is drawn. What is the probability that the card is a heart?
The probability that the card drawn is a heart is 1/4, as there are 13 hearts in a standard deck of 52 cards (13 hearts out of 52 cards total).
